Foundation repair services involve assessing and addressing issues related to the stability and integrity of a building’s foundation. These services typically include diagnosing problems such as cracks, settling, or shifting, and implementing solutions to restore the foundation’s stability. Techniques used may involve underpinning, piering, or slabjacking, among others, to prevent further damage and ensure the safety of the structure. The goal is to correct existing issues and reinforce the foundation to support the building’s weight and prevent future problems.
Problems that foundation repair services help solve often stem from soil movement, moisture fluctuations, poor construction practices, or aging materials. Common signs of foundation issues include uneven floors, cracked walls, sticking doors or windows, and gaps around window frames. Left unaddressed, these problems can lead to more serious structural damage, increased repair costs, and safety concerns. Foundation repair aims to stabilize the affected areas, mitigate ongoing movement, and protect the overall integrity of the property.
Various types of properties utilize foundation repair services, including residential homes, commercial buildings, and multi-family complexes. Homes with basements or crawl spaces are particularly susceptible to foundation issues, especially in areas with expansive clay soils or high moisture levels. Commercial properties, such as retail stores or office buildings, may also require foundation stabilization to maintain safety and operational stability. The overview below groups typical Foundation Repair Service proj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Rock County, WI.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Foundation Repair Costs - The typical cost for foundation repair services ranges from $2,000 to $7,500, depending on the extent of the damage and the repair method used. Smaller cracks or minor settling may cost around $2,000, while extensive underpinning can reach higher amounts. Local pros can provide estimates based on specific needs.
Crack Repair Expenses - Repairing cracks in a foundation usually costs between $500 and $3,000. Minor cracks may be repaired for under $1,000, whereas larger or more complex crack repairs tend to be on the higher end. Costs vary based on crack size and location.
Piering and Underpinning - Installing piers or underpinning to stabilize a foundation generally costs from $3,000 to $10,000. The price depends on the number of piers needed and soil conditions. Local service providers can assess the specific project to give accurate estimates.
Cost Factors and Variations - Overall foundation repair costs can vary widely based on factors like soil type, foundation size, and repair complexity. Typical projects in Rock County, WI, might fall within the $2,000 to $15,000 range. Contact local professionals for tailored cost assessments.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What are common signs of foundation issues? Signs may include visible cracks in walls or floors, uneven or sagging floors, sticking doors or windows, and gaps around window or door frames.
How long does foundation repair typically take? The duration varies depending on the extent of the damage and the repair method, with local contractors providing estimates based on the specific situation.
Are foundation repairs necessary for minor cracks? Not all cracks require repair; a professional assessment can determine if repairs are needed to prevent further damage.
What methods do foundation repair contractors use? Common methods include piering, underpinning, and slab stabilization, selected based on the foundation type and damage severity.
How can I prevent future foundation problems? Proper drainage, maintaining soil moisture levels, and addressing minor issues promptly can help reduce the risk of future foundation issues.
